General description
Methyl indole-5-carboxylate (Methyl 1H-indole-5-carboxylate), a substituted 1H-indole, can be prepared by the esterification of indole-5-carboxylic acid. Its efficacy as a substrate for indigoid generation has been assessed.
Application
Methyl indole-5-carboxylate may be used as a reactant in the following processes:
- biosynthesis of inhibitors of protein kinases
- metal-free Friedel-Crafts alkylation
- preparation of diphenylsulfonium ylides from Martin′s sulfurane
- cross dehydrogenative coupling reactions
- synthesis of indirubin derivatives
- preparation of aminoindolylacetates
Methyl indole-5-carboxylate may be used in the preparation of:
- methyl indoline-5-carboxylate
- 1H-indole-5-carbohydrazide
- dimethyl 1H-indole-3,5-dicarboxylate
